In November 2025, 绿奴天花板 President Pat Pitney announced her intention to retire at the end of May 2026. The 绿奴天花板 Board of Regents initiated a process to select a visionary, strategic, and collaborative leader with experience managing large, complex organizations to bring a modern understanding of higher education to serve as 绿奴天花板's next permanent president.

University of Alaska Board of Regents selects Matthew Cooper as system鈥檚 18th president
The University of Alaska Board of Regents voted to appoint long-time Alaskan and former 绿奴天花板 General Counsel Matthew Cooper as the next President of the University of Alaska. President-Designee Cooper brings 13 years of 绿奴天花板 experience to the role and will succeed President Pat Pitney following her retirement in May. President-Designee Cooper currently serves as Of Counsel at Davis Wright Tremaine LLP, a national law firm with offices in Anchorage; his first day as 绿奴天花板 president will be August 3, 2026. Matthew 鈥淢att鈥 Cooper
University of Alaska President-Designee
Office of the President
President-Designee Cooper spent 13 years in the 绿奴天花板 Office of the General Counsel, including four as General Counsel from 2020 to 2024. He joined the office in 2011 and rose through increasing levels of responsibility, advising the Board of Regents, system administration, and the three universities on higher education law, board governance, and complex institutional risk. As General Counsel, he oversaw the finalization and implementation of the 绿奴天花板 Land Grant Initiative, a decades-long university priority that will allow 绿奴天花板 to receive its full federal land-grant allotment. He also actively participated in and assisted with many of 绿奴天花板's key priorities, including intellectual property commercialization and operational efficiency. His professional approach centers on solving conflict through consensus and collaboration, an orientation that has shaped his work as a trusted advisor to University leadership.
University of Alaska President Search Process
The committee conducted initial interviews via Zoom in early April. Candidates then came to the campus, meeting with the search committee, constituent groups, and the Board of Regents with a goal of identifying 绿奴天花板鈥檚 next president in early to mid-May.

Search Firm Listening Sessions
- 绿奴天花板 students, staff, and faculty, and community members from around the state were invited to provide input and feedback on the characteristics and qualities they would like to see in 绿奴天花板鈥檚 next permanent president during listening sessions the week of December 8 in Juneau, Fairbanks, and Anchorage by WittKieffer, the executive search firm contracted by the Board of Regents to assist in the presidential search.
- Students, staff, and faculty at 绿奴天花板A, 绿奴天花板F, and 绿奴天花板S, as well as the System Office, were able to attend their listening sessions in-person or virtually. Members of the general public could attend the In-person listening sessions.
-
An anonymous feedback survey was also available through December 19 for those unable to attend in person or via Zoom.
